
Iran is experiencing widespread protests driven by economic hardship and political discontent, with thousands reportedly killed amid a harsh government crackdown. The US, under President Trump, has oscillated between threats of military action and sanctions, ultimately delaying strikes partly due to regional allies' concerns and Iran's partial concessions. The Iranian regime faces internal pressures and international sanctions, while exiled Iranians protest abroad. Narratives differ on whether unrest is a genuine uprising or foreign-instigated, with experts warning of potential long-term instability without major reforms.
